Mailinator

Mailinator is a free, disposable email service that allows users to create email aliases on the fly without registration. It can be useful for testing or other purposes where you don't want to provide your real email.

Freebird

Freebird is a free and open-source alternative to Microsoft Project. It is a project management software used for planning, tracking, and managing projects, tasks and resources. It allows users to create Gantt charts and provides reporting features.
